Linux修改主机名

要在Linux系统中修改主机名,可以按照以下步骤操作:

方法 1:使用 hostnamectl 命令(推荐)

  1. 打开终端,以管理员权限登录或切换到具有足够权限的用户。

  2. 查看当前主机名,可以使用以下命令:

    hostnamectl
    
  3. 若要修改主机名,请使用 hostnamectl 命令并指定新的主机名。将 替换为您要设置的新主机名:

    sudo hostnamectl set-hostname <new_hostname>
    
  4. 重新启动系统或使用以下命令使新的主机名立即生效:

    sudo systemctl restart systemd-hostnamed
    
  5. 验证新主机名是否已生效:

    hostnamectl
    

方法 2:手动修改主机名文件

  1. 打开终端,以管理员权限登录或切换到具有足够权限的用户。

  2. 编辑 /etc/hostname 文件并将新主机名写入其中。可以使用文本编辑器(如nanovi)来编辑文件。将 替换为您要设置的新主机名。

    sudo nano /etc/hostname
    

    或者

    sudo vi /etc/hostname
    

    在文件中输入新主机名并保存。

  3. 编辑 /etc/hosts 文件,找到包含旧主机名的行,将其替换为新主机名。这样做可以确保系统知道新主机名与本地主机的关联。

    sudo nano /etc/hosts
    

    或者

    sudo vi /etc/hosts
    

    在文件中找到旧主机名并将其替换为新主机名。保存文件。

  4. 重新启动系统或使用以下命令使新的主机名立即生效:

    sudo systemctl restart systemd-hostnamed
    
  5. 验证新主机名是否已生效:

    hostname
    

你可能感兴趣的:(Linux,linux,运维,服务器)